Description
Offered with no onward chain! This beautifully finished three bedroom, semi detached property is a rare addition to the market featuring private views across the Devizes Canal, a fully kitted external workshop and a knocked through kitchen/garden room with a fully automatic sun awning.
The accommodation briefly comprises; Entrance hall; sitting room with solid oak flooring and sound insulated ceiling; a well sized, modern kitchen which has been knocked through into the garden room which is warmed in winter by a wet underfloor heating system and cooled in summer with the previously mentioned automatic sun awning.
On the first floor are three good size bedrooms, one with storage; alongside a modern family shower room installed in 2018.
To the rear you have a delightful garden which features private views of the Devizes Canal; a patio space with veranda; an external workshop with electricity and water as well as a rain water harvester to provide water for any water features as well as supply water if for any hose pipe bans etc. At the front of the property you have a drive which can comfortably fit two cars.
The property is situated within walking distance of multiple primary schools throughout Devizes, such as Nursteed school & The Trinity school and also Devizes Secondary School & Sixth Form College. Amenity options are abundant being within a fifteen minute walk from the Devizes Town Centre.
Warmed by gas central heating and enhanced by double glazing throughout. The electrics have all been checked and brought up to the regulations of when I write this description.
Devizes is a splendid historic market town that still hosts a weekly traditional outdoor market.
There is an excellent range of shopping facilities and the town provides easy access to the larger cities of Georgian Bath and the cathedral city of Salisbury. There are mainline railway stations at nearby Pewsey and Chippenham (London, Paddington) approx. one hour twenty minutes, with junction 17 of the M4 motorway close at hand.
